.text-snippet{padding:100px 0;width:100%}.text-snippet__content{width:55%}.text-snippet__image{padding-bottom:20px;text-align:center;width:40%}.text-snippet__image img{max-width:100%}@media screen and (max-height:900px),screen and (max-width:1600px){.text-snippet{padding:50px 0}}@media screen and (max-width:576px){.text-snippet{padding:25px 0}.text-snippet__content,.text-snippet__image{width:100%}.text-snippet__image img{max-width:60%}}